UPG PS Chandpur Pahariatola: A Rural Primary School in Jharkhand

UPG PS Chandpur Pahariatola, a primary school located in the Amrapura block of Pakaur district, Jharkhand, serves the educational needs of the rural community. Established in 2002, this government-run co-educational institution provides primary education (Classes 1-5) for children in the surrounding area. The school's management falls under the Department of Education, ensuring adherence to government standards and curriculum.

The school building itself comprises two classrooms, each maintained in good condition to facilitate effective learning. A dedicated room is available for non-teaching activities, supporting the school's overall functionality. While lacking a boundary wall and electricity, the school boasts a functional library with an impressive 200 books, fostering a love of reading among the students. The school's commitment to its students extends to providing mid-day meals, prepared and served on the school premises.

Further underscoring the school's dedication to student welfare is the provision of both boys' and girls' toilets, ensuring a hygienic and safe environment for all. The drinking water needs of the students are met by functional hand pumps, ensuring a reliable source of clean water. The school’s instruction is primarily in Hindi, reflecting the local language and promoting accessibility for the students. The school's rural location means it is accessible by all-weather roads, removing barriers to attendance.

The school's curriculum focuses on providing a foundational education in Hindi, covering essential primary-level subjects. Two male teachers dedicate themselves to providing quality instruction to the students. The absence of a pre-primary section means that enrollment begins at Class 1, emphasizing the school's focus on primary education. The academic year commences in April, aligning with the regional academic calendar.

Despite the absence of computer-aided learning and computers within the facility, the school strives to deliver high-quality education utilizing available resources. The lack of ramps currently means that access for disabled children is limited, an area the school may look to improve upon in the future. The school does not offer higher secondary education; it solely focuses on providing a strong foundation for students before transitioning to other institutions for higher levels of schooling.
